Circuit Breaker Replacement in Orem, UT
Circuit breaker replacement services involve removing outdated or faulty circuit breakers and installing new units to ensure the electrical system functions safely and efficiently. This service is commonly needed when circuit breakers trip frequently, fail to reset, or show signs of damage such as burning or corrosion. Projects often include upgrading existing panels, replacing individual breakers, or installing new breaker units to accommodate additional electrical demands. Homeowners typically want to understand the signs indicating a breaker needs replacement and how the process can improve electrical safety and reliability throughout their property.
Before requesting circuit breaker replacement, property owners should consider the age and condition of their current electrical system, as well as any recent electrical issues experienced. It’s important to determine whether the existing panel can support new or upgraded breakers and to understand the scope of work involved, including potential upgrades to the main panel or wiring. Clarifying these details helps ensure the replacement process addresses current electrical needs and enhances overall safety and performance within the home or property.

Common Circuit Breaker Replacement Jobs
Residential Circuit Breaker Replacement - upgrading outdated or damaged circuit breakers to ensure proper electrical function.
Main Breaker Replacement - replacing the main electrical panel breaker for improved safety and capacity.
Arc Fault Circuit Interrupter (AFCI) Replacement - installing or replacing AFCIs to protect against electrical fires.
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ter (GFCI) Replacement - updating GFCIs in kitchens, bathrooms, or outdoor areas for safety compliance.
Partial Panel Replacement - upgrading specific circuits or sections of the electrical panel as needed.
Emergency Circuit Breaker Repair - addressing tripped or malfunctioning breakers that disrupt power supply.
Circuit Breaker Replacement Questions
When should a circuit breaker be replaced? Circuit breakers should be replaced if they trip frequently, show signs of damage, or fail to reset properly.
What are common signs indicating a circuit breaker needs replacement? Signs include frequent tripping, burning smells, scorch marks, or physical damage to the breaker.
Can a homeowner replace a circuit breaker themselves? Replacing a circuit breaker involves working with electrical components and should be performed by a qualified professional for safety.
What types of projects typically require circuit breaker replacement? Projects include upgrades to electrical systems, repairs after electrical faults, or modernization of home wiring.
